EB-5 Regional Centers [Web Seminar]
This 90 minute web seminar was originally presented live on February 2, 2012
EB-5 has become a go to source for business organizations seeking a viable source of alternative capital. Join this teleconference to learn more about the requirements of Regional Center Designation.
- Determining if Regional Center Designation Is an Option
- Amendments to the Regional Center Designation
- Project "Pre-approvals"—The Exemplar I-526
- Hot Button Issues—TEAs, Bridge Financing and Implementation of Premium Processing, and USCIS EB-5 Decision Board
- I-924A and Ongoing Regional Center Compliance
